Our verdict is Likely benign. The variant received -1 ACMG points: 0P and 1B. BS1_Supporting
The NM_001080476.3(GRXCR1):c.774G>A(p.Met258Ile) variant causes a missense change involving the alteration of a conserved nucleotide. The variant allele was found at a frequency of 0.0000328 in 1,613,972 control chromosomes in the GnomAD database, including 1 homozygotes. Variant has been reported in ClinVar as Uncertain significance (★★).

The p.Met258Ile variant in GRXCR1 has not been previously reported in individual s with hearing loss. This variant has been identified in 7/9808 African chromoso mes by the Exome Aggregation Consortium (ExAC, http://exac.broadinstitute.org; d bSNP rs200029324). Although this variant has been seen in the general population , its frequency is not high enough to rule out a pathogenic role. Computational prediction tools and conservation analyses do not provide strong support for or against an impact to the protein. In summary, the clinical significance of the p .Met258Ile variant is uncertain. -

The c.774G>A (p.M258I) alteration is located in exon 4 (coding exon 4) of the GRXCR1 gene. This alteration results from a G to A substitution at nucleotide position 774, causing the methionine (M) at amino acid position 258 to be replaced by an isoleucine (I). Based on insufficient or conflicting evidence, the clinical significance of this alteration remains unclear. -

This sequence change replaces methionine with isoleucine at codon 258 of the GRXCR1 protein (p.Met258Ile). The methionine residue is moderately conserved and there is a small physicochemical difference between methionine and isoleucine. This variant is present in population databases (rs200029324, ExAC 0.07%). This variant has not been reported in the literature in individuals affected with GRXCR1-related conditions. ClinVar contains an entry for this variant (Variation ID: 504594). Algorithms developed to predict the effect of missense changes on protein structure and function are either unavailable or do not agree on the potential impact of this missense change (SIFT: "Tolerated"; PolyPhen-2: "Probably Damaging"; Align-GVGD: "Class C0"). In summary, the available evidence is currently insufficient to determine the role of this variant in disease. Therefore, it has been classified as a Variant of Uncertain Significance. -
